Grand Total not showing correctly

Hello,
I am developing a Training Report to show different visuals,

One of the visuals is to show the number of Training taken by each department, I have 3 Tables in the Model, 

  • Employee Information,
  • Training Master, & 
  • Emp Training which is a fact table having the Employee ID and Training ID linked with each as a single relationship 

    when I add a scorecard for total training showing 213 training,

    However, when I convert it to a chart and add a department in the Axis, so I can show the breakdown of each department,  the numbers don't match the total number of training against each Department. 


    Can you advise why the breakdown is showing a different number than the total? I have tried to use a measure as a Distinct count but still the same issue. What would be the solution for this?
